Output 26aa641aba175907c2fe681c8583c3a61fb43065192ecacfaf6025958af13401:0

value
323020230
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0aefa347d09ce1138c8c25ae29e0f035851eef93 OP_EQUALVERIFY OP_CHECKSIG
address
1zpqFF4chXzbL5Ke4ueHJraqJwXcrpWe8
transaction
26aa641aba175907c2fe681c8583c3a61fb43065192ecacfaf6025958af13401
confirmations
291836
spent
true